Preloader image
Back

Каким-образом функционируют API-обращения

Каким-образом функционируют API-обращения

API-запросы являют по-сути механизм обмена среди различными программными решениями. API, или механизм программирования программ, фиксирует набор правил и методов, посредством помощью данных-правил одна программа способна обращаться ко иной для вывода информации или выполнения действий. Подобный подход дает-возможность системам передавать сведениями без-необходимости непосредственного подключения к закрытой структуре одна Вулкан казино друга.

Во современной цифровой инфраструктуре запросы-API задействуются регулярно: во веб-приложениях, смартфонных платформах, инструментах аналитики а-также подключаемых системах. Во практических разборах и реальных сценариях, среди-них игровые автоматы на деньги, обычно показывается, каким-образом API-обращения помогают настроить передачу данных между пользовательской плюс backend частью, и еще для несколькими платформами.

Основной механизм функционирования API-интерфейса

Работа API строится вокруг схемы «клиент–сервер». Приложение передает запрос, и серверная-часть обрабатывает запрос и передает ответ. Отправителем может быть браузер, портативное приложение а-также другая система. Backend обрабатывает обращение, проводит нужные действия плюс отправляет результат в определенном казино Вулкан формате.

Каждый запрос имеет определенные параметры, они объясняют, какие информацию нужно загрузить а-также какое-именно действие провести. Backend разбирает запрос, валидирует запрос правильность плюс формирует результат. Такой механизм дает-возможность разделить ответственность для разными компонентами платформы.

Устройство API-обращения

Запрос-API формируется на-основе нескольких основных частей. Прежде-всего первую линию указанным-элементом endpoint, то-есть endpoint, он ведет на конкретный объект. Дополнительно внутри обращении указывается тип-команды, определяющий тип операции. Дополнительно имеют-возможность отправляться служебные-заголовки плюс тело запроса.

Headers содержат вспомогательную сведения, например формат данных либо настройки доступа. Body команды задействуется ради пересылки информации к backend. Не все обращения имеют body, однако внутри Игровые автоматы случае передачи сведений body имеет ключевую позицию.

Схема обращения обязана соответствовать требованиям API. После ошибке схемы backend способен отклонить команду или вернуть ошибку. Вследствие-этого важно учитывать правила, указанные внутри инструкции.

HTTP-команды плюс их функция

Для использования интерфейса-API чаще зачастую применяются HTTP-методы. Каждый среди данных-команд проводит конкретную функцию. Например, GET-метод используется с-целью загрузки сведений, метод-POST — для создания дополнительных элементов, метод-PUT — с-целью обновления, а DELETE — для стирания.

Подбор метода определяется на-основе операции. Во-время запросе данных задействуется один тип запроса, при корректировке — иной. Подобный принцип позволяет унифицировать Вулкан казино обмен плюс создать процесс понятным.

Методы дополнительно сказываются на-структуру формат обращения и реакцию сервера. Например, команда на получение данных не может изменять статус системы, а обращение ради формирование записи предполагает передачу информации в содержимом запроса.

Форматы обмена сведений

API-запросы используют разные структуры сведений. Самыми распространенными считаются JSON-формат а-также XML. JavaScript-Object-Notation отличается компактностью а-также простотой обработки, из-за-этого задействуется чаще. XML применяется менее-часто, при-этом сохраняется актуальным в некоторых платформах казино Вулкан.

Вид сведений фиксирует, по-какой-схеме данные упорядочена и передается среди системами. Клиент и сервер должны использовать одинаковый и общий же тип, для-того-чтобы точно обрабатывать информацию. Расхождение структуры способно создать ко ошибкам обработки.

Во-время работе с API-интерфейсом критично принимать-во-внимание формат-кодировки и структуру данных. Это обеспечивает корректную пересылку сведений а-также снижает искажения.

Выполнение обращения на серверной-части

Затем-после приема запроса сервер проводит обращения разбор. Сначала осуществляется контроль аргументов и прав доступа. После-этого система устанавливает, конкретные команды требуется запустить. Это имеет-возможность быть обращение к системе сведений, активация метода или запуск вычислений.

После проведения процесса backend создает ответ. В результате находятся информация либо сообщение касательно Игровые автоматы итоге выполнения. Когда возникает ошибка, backend отдает нужный статус и описание ошибки.

Обработка обращения имеет-возможность содержать ряд этапов, охватывая контроль информации, проверку-доступа и журналирование. Такой-подход создает платформу более стабильной и управляемой.

Отклик API плюс его состав

Отклик API-интерфейса имеет данные плюс служебную информацию. Результат Вулкан казино как-правило содержит код ответа, он указывает статус обработки запроса. Допустим, корректное выполнение фиксируется одним номером, ошибка — другим.

Body отклика включает непосредственные информацию. Данные могут формироваться в-виде список элементов, конкретную сущность а-также результат. Структура результата обязан отвечать настройкам системы.

Статусы ответа позволяют оперативно понять итог API-запроса. Они используются ради анализа сбоев а-также выработки решений на системы.

Идентификация плюс безопасность

Ради защиты сведений API-интерфейс задействует средства проверки. Они казино Вулкан дают-возможность проверить, что-конкретно обращение передан корректным источником. Без авторизации серверная-часть имеет-возможность заблокировать обращение либо ограничить доступ к данным.

Обычно задействуются access-токены, API-ключи проверки и другие способы проверки. Такие данные отправляются в служебных-полях запроса. Backend валидирует значения плюс формирует решение касательно открытии разрешений.

Контроль еще охватывает защиту в-отношении вредоносных обращений а-также атак. Такая-система реализуется с использованием валидации входных информации а-также ограничения количества запросов Игровые автоматы.

Проблемы и их обработка

При взаимодействии со API-интерфейсом способны происходить проблемы. Они имеют-возможность являться вызваны со неправильным схемой обращения, недостатком сведений либо проблемами на сервере. С-целью любой ошибки задан статус а-также разъяснение.

Контроль сбоев помогает клиенту правильно реагировать на проблемы. Система способен разбирать код плюс выполнять подходящие шаги. К-примеру, отправить-снова запрос а-также вывести уведомление.

Корректная контроль проблем обеспечивает работу через API более стабильным плюс контролируемым.

Применение API-запросов

API-обращения задействуются для объединения разных систем. С их использованием приложения получают данные, пересылают данные плюс работают через другими сервисами. Данный-подход Вулкан казино дает-возможность собирать многоуровневые цифровые решения на-основе независимых компонентов.

Например, API применяется для выгрузки информации со backend, согласования сведений между устройствами плюс обмена с третьими платформами. Подобный подход формирует решения гибкими а-также масштабируемыми.

API-интерфейс еще задействуется для оптимизации операций. Автоматические-процессы могут передавать запросы, получать сведения и запускать операции без контроля человека. Такой-подход ускоряет выполнение процессов а-также уменьшает вероятность ошибок.

Настройка работы со API

Для корректной эксплуатации со API необходимо казино Вулкан принимать-во-внимание нагрузку. Частые обращения имеют-возможность вызывать давление внутри сервер, из-за-этого задействуются механизмы кэширования и регулирования интенсивности.

Улучшение охватывает снижение размера передаваемых информации, использование компрессии а-также точную настройку аргументов. Данный-подход помогает ускорить передачу данными плюс уменьшить перегрузку внутри сервер.

Также необходимо контролировать стабильность сети и правильно учитывать паузы. Такая-обработка обеспечивает работу значительно стабильным.

Перспективы применения API-интерфейса

С IT-решений интерфейс-API становится базой обмена между платформами. API задействуется во облачных решениях, смартфонных сервисах и бизнес решениях. Интерфейс-API дает-возможность интегрировать несколько компоненты во единую среду Игровые автоматы.

Адаптивность плюс унификация обеспечивают API важным механизмом разработки. Данный-инструмент помогает эффективно создавать интеграции а-также подстраивать решения под-актуальные изменяющиеся задачи. Со-временем важность интерфейса-API станет только увеличиваться, поскольку количество цифровых сервисов непрерывно расширяться.

Использование запросов-API создает быстрый пересылку сведениями плюс упрощает формирование комплексных программных систем. Это обеспечивает их основным частью актуальной инженерии плюс цифровой среды.

Вспомогательные особенности работы API-интерфейса

При проектировании интерфейса-API значимую функцию занимает документация. Данный-раздел содержит доступные команды, значения команд, структуру ответов а-также вероятные проблемы. При-отсутствии подробной Вулкан казино документации взаимодействие среди платформами оказывается затруднительным, так-как отсутствует согласованное понимание структуры информации а-также механизма работы.

Также одним ключевым фактором считается версионирование API-интерфейса. С-течением изменений логика плюс набор-функций способны обновляться, из-за-этого используются версии, что помогают поддерживать старые и актуальные форматы параллельно. Данный-подход необходимо ради сохранения совместимости плюс предотвращения сбоев во интеграции.

Дополнительно применяется механизм контроля частоты запросов. Он ограничивает объем обращений за определенный казино Вулкан период плюс предотвращает давление backend. При нарушении ограничения система может на-время закрыть подключение а-также передавать отдельный номер сбоя.

Сохранение-данных и ускорение взаимодействия

Сохранение используется ради сокращения количества запросов на backend. Когда сведения не изменяются постоянно, сведения разрешается записать на уровне системы а-также буферного сервиса. Такая-техника позволяет повысить-скорость загрузку а-также уменьшить давление на инфраструктуру Игровые автоматы.

Используются несколько подходы к сохранению, охватывая сохранение ответов во кэше, использование специальных headers плюс настройку срока актуальности данных. Данный подход особенно эффективен в-случае взаимодействии со регулярно запрашиваемой информацией.

Повышение-эффективности с-помощью кэширование формирует работу намного эффективным а-также уменьшает время-ожидания во-время получении сведений. Данный-фактор необходимо с-целью систем при большой интенсивностью и значительным количеством пользователей.

Логирование плюс контроль

Для управления работы API-интерфейса используется логирование. Backend записывает приходящие запросы, ответы а-также фиксируемые ошибки. Эти записи применяются ради разбора а-также выявления ошибок.

Наблюдение дает-возможность контролировать состояние сервиса во реальном интервале. Такая-система фиксирует количество запросов, скорость ответа и степень нагрузки. В-случае отклонениях сервис способна выдавать сообщения а-также запускать резервные операции.

Журналирование а-также мониторинг дают-возможность поддерживать устойчивость интерфейса-API и своевременно отвечать на сбои. Это выступает значимой составляющей обслуживания а-также сопровождения онлайн сервисов.

admin
admin
https://theplugtech.com

We use cookies to give you the best experience. Cookie Policy